The fruit that helps me feel full and calm at night is the banana

Until recently eating a banana during the night was not in my plans. This is a fruit that I used for lunch or in the afternoon, as it is known to fight fluid retention and prevent bloating in the abdomen. But one night, as I wasn’t full from dinner, I decided to eat a banana and the truth is that I slept better than ever. It may be a coincidence but I repeated this movement the following evenings and saw a difference in my well-being. Somehow it became a habit.

It doesn’t seem like a coincidence to me, as banana is a filling fruit that curbs hunger after a light dinner, has a sweet taste that fights the need for dessert, and can keep us from temptation. ” Bananas reduce stress thanks to their tryptophan content, which helps produce serotonin (hormone of joy). In addition, the banana is rich in carbohydrates and natural fibers, which is why it creates a feeling of satiety. The potassium and magnesium contained in the banana relax the muscles,” explains María José Crispín, doctor and nutritionist at Clínica Menorca.

Of course, it does not mean that banana causes sleepiness, but it has properties and vitamins that relax the nervous system and lead to relaxation. Nutritionist Laura Parada emphasizes: “Bananas contain a small amount of tryptophan and we need to consume a lot of them for our body to produce melatonin and serotonin.”

Banana at night

This fruit may have been linked to caloric intake, however no research shows that it increases weight. Bananas have been misunderstood when compared to other fruits, for example 100 grams of apple contain 50 calories, while 100 grams of banana contain 90. So you can consume it without guilt, the main thing is to stick to a balanced diet.
